Manchester City's Premier League clash against Arsenal has become the first football match in England to be postponed amid fears over the deadly Coronavirus outbreak.

The match, which was set to take place on Wednesday evening, has been called off after Olympiacos owner Evangelos Marinakis tested positive for Covid-19.


While the Manchester City vs Arsenal game is the first Premier League match to have been postponed as a result of the outbreak, the virus has had a more far-reaching effect on sport in Europe and beyond.

In Italy, all sport has been called off until April 3, while Spanish La Liga games are taking place behind closed doors.

Matches are going ahead without spectators or being called off in France, Germany, Switzerland, Romania, Bulgaria, Slovenia and Slovakia, among other countries.
